My husband and I recently hired Powell Electric to do some work for a family member and were so pleased with them we hired them for our major project. We upgraded our service to a 200 amp box and added many new circuits and outlets throughout the house.
Ed the owner did a detailed walkthrough with us prior to the estimate to help us determine the best way to do it in terms of both costs and interior damage to the house (such as holes cut in the wall, etc.)
The crew that came did an amazing job, led by Wyatt, the owner’s son. Wyatt was very patient and extremely good at detailed problem solving as issues arose. He is very knowledgeable.
We really appreciated the effort Wyatt, Zach, and Dylan went to in order to get the job done. We were shocked at how little they had to cut holes in interior walls, given the layout of our house. One of them even crawled into a space in the attic we thought impossible to access in order to get the circuit where it needed to be without cutting any drywall! We put off this project for many years, expecting to have major drywall repairs to do after the project was completed. However, the only thing inside the house we need to patch is a small hole (1-inch x 4-inch) in the kitchen, and that was only because there was unexpectedly no drywall in that spot, only drywall paper on top.
There were other issues that made this job tricky. Throughout the entire process Wyatt communicated with us, seeking our input when there were options or decisions needed.
Wyatt, Zach, and Dylan were all pleasant and respectful and made the process go smoothly.
We are so pleased with the results of the project. We have no hesitation at all in recommending Powell Electric for both small jobs like our family member’s, and large jobs like ours.
